
Bang & Olufsen has announced that the company will be coming out with a 103-inch plasma TV this summer. Falling under B&O’s BeoVision 4 line of high-end plasma sets, the BeoVision 4-103 features the line’s audio and video technologies, including Automatic Colour Management system that comes with a built-in camera that checks for the plasma screen’s picture degredation every 120 hours of use. The built-in tech then adjusts the color balance accordingly to give users an optimized picture.
B&O’s BeoSystem 3 stage manager and VisionClear technology also helps optimize the screen brightness and colors, while Automatic Picture Control senses ambient light and adjusts the light output from the screen accordingly.
Weighing 1,100 pounds, the BeoVision 4-103 sports a motorized stand that raises the screen to reveal a center channel speaker (B&O’s high-quality triangular BeoLab 10 speaker unit) and motorized hinges that users can enable to tilt and swivel the screen via the set’s remote control.
The Beovision 4-103 is now available through pre-orders in Europe with prices set at $137,000, and is packaged with B&O’s $5,377 BeoSound speaker kit and a touchscreen remote.
